The TLC3574IPW from Texas Instruments is a high-performance 14-bit SAR (Successive Approximation Register) analog-to-digital converter (ADC) designed for precision measurement applications. Housed in a compact 20-TSSOP package, this ADC integrates a single converter with SPI-compatible data interface, enabling seamless communication with microcontrollers or DSPs. It operates with a dual-supply configuration—5V analog supply and 2.7V to 5.5V digital supply—making it versatile for mixed-voltage systems. With a sampling rate of 200kSPS and 1:1 sample-and-hold (S/H) to ADC ratio, it delivers high-speed, low-latency conversions. The device supports 2 or 4 differential inputs, offering flexibility for multi-channel systems.
